Tate is seeking a Care Charges and Direct Payments Administrator in Potters Bar with a salary of £28,000 per annum. This role involves managing payroll, maintaining records for direct payment users, and ensuring compliance with regulations.
The ideal candidate will have experience in payroll administration and proficiency in SAP and Excel. This position offers an early finish on Fridays and a supportive team environment.
